Transaction c4d43b156fcd64c327137be612f8c66dd77b45c56005443d5dd0e1c87875db25
1 Input
2 Outputs
- c4d43b156fcd64c327137be612f8c66dd77b45c56005443d5dd0e1c87875db25:0
- c4d43b156fcd64c327137be612f8c66dd77b45c56005443d5dd0e1c87875db25:1
value 2155848
address 32G4oh5EkjJhmEt6X9uVXVHzizADMsCJ3i
value 7916700
address 15DDnxWTSn4bNU7GUyJYF3JgWnqW3T37mX